Self-defense can empower women in multiple ways, contributing to their physical, mental, and emotional well-being. Here’s how self-defense training can foster empowerment:

1. Increased Confidence

  • Overcoming Fear: Knowing how to protect oneself helps women overcome fear and hesitation, particularly in threatening situations.
  • Sense of Control: Self-defense training empowers women to feel in control of their safety, boosting self-esteem and self-assurance in public and private spaces.

2. Physical Strength and Fitness

  • Improved Fitness: Training in self-defense improves physical fitness, strength, and agility. This can lead to a greater sense of personal power and overall health.
  • Preparedness: Learning techniques like blocking, striking, and escaping holds enables women to physically respond if faced with danger, creating a sense of readiness.

3. Mental Resilience and Assertiveness

  • Quick Decision-Making: Self-defense teaches women to think fast and make decisions in high-pressure situations, cultivating mental resilience.
  • Assertiveness: Women learn to establish and communicate their boundaries, making them more assertive in everyday life, both in physical and emotional contexts.

4. Breaking Social Barriers

  • Challenging Stereotypes: Self-defense helps break societal stereotypes that portray women as physically weak or incapable of self-protection. It challenges norms and empowers women to take control of their personal security.
  • Equalizing Power Dynamics: By equipping women with the ability to defend themselves, the power dynamics in male-dominated spaces can shift, fostering greater equality and mutual respect.

5. Awareness and Prevention

  • Situational Awareness: Self-defense classes teach women to be aware of their surroundings, which reduces the chances of falling victim to unexpected attacks.
  • Preventive Action: Women become more knowledgeable about risky situations, which helps them take preventive actions to avoid harm.

6. Legal and Social Awareness

  • Understanding Rights: Through training, women can learn about their legal rights, empowering them to act decisively in unsafe situations or report harassment or abuse.
  • Access to Resources: Self-defense programs often connect women to community resources like shelters, hotlines, and legal aid, fostering a support network.

7. Emotional and Psychological Empowerment

  • Reducing Anxiety: Women often experience anxiety around safety. Self-defense can alleviate this by making women feel more secure and capable of defending themselves.
  • Healing from Trauma: For women who have faced abuse or violence, self-defense training can be therapeutic, helping them regain control over their bodies and emotions.

8. Community Building

  • Support Networks: Women in self-defense classes often form strong bonds and support systems with other participants. This fosters a sense of solidarity, creating a safe space for sharing experiences and learning together.
  • Role Models: Empowered women become role models in their communities, inspiring others to take action and promoting a culture of safety and respect.
